Piney Woods

360Hoods_0074_0007

Built by Geordan Communities, Piney Woods is a bungalow community located in Opelika off of Veteran’s Parkway between Hwy 280 and Oakbowery Road. Convenient to Auburn and Opelika, this quaint community will feature 20 cottage homes with historic flair. From the low $100′s
